Ingredients

2 1/2 cups dry chickpeas
olive oil
garlic salt
black pepper
clipped rosemary
soy sauce
oriental sesame oil ( dark )
hot chili powder
tomato juice and curry powder
Kadami (Lebanese Roasted Chick Peas) is a Middle Eastern snack that has gained popularity worldwide. This healthy snack option is a perfect alternative to potato chips or other high-fat snacks. Not only are roasted chickpeas nutritious, but they are also delicious. The seasoning in this recipe enhances the taste of the chickpeas, making it a perfect snack for any time of the day. This snack can also be served as an appetizer or a side dish to a full meal.

Instructions

1.Preheat oven to 375°F.
2.Rinse and drain chickpeas. Pat them dry.
3.In a large mixing bowl, combine chickpeas, olive oil, garlic salt, black pepper, clipped rosemary, soy sauce, oriental sesame oil, hot chili powder, tomato juice and curry powder.
4.Place chickpea mixture into a baking tray in a single layer.
5.Bake in the preheated oven for approximately 45 minutes until the chickpeas are crispy. Stir occasionally to prevent burning.
6.Remove from the oven and serve.

HEALTH & BENEFITS

Chickpeas are an excellent source of plant-based protein and fiber. They are also packed with essential vitamins and minerals such as folate, iron, and manganese. Roasting helps retain the nutritional value of chickpeas.
The health benefits of consuming chickpeas include better digestion, improved heart health, and better blood sugar control.
